Comment 3 Jesse Barnes 2009-04-13 10:08:21 UTC
Can you try starting w/o an xorg.conf (just rename it or something)?

Also, to get a backtrace you could start the server under gdb instead of trying to attach to it after start, or add a "sleep(3);" somewhere to xf86-video-intel's preinit function to give you time to attach.
Comment 4 kevin kaploe 2009-04-13 10:38:12 UTC
(In reply to comment #3)
> Can you try starting w/o an xorg.conf (just rename it or something)?
> 
> Also, to get a backtrace you could start the server under gdb instead of trying
> to attach to it after start, or add a "sleep(3);" somewhere to
> xf86-video-intel's preinit function to give you time to attach.
> 

i am not familiar with gdb, how do you start a program from within it?
Comment 5 Jesse Barnes 2009-04-13 10:43:40 UTC
Something like:
  # gdb /usr/bin/Xorg
  ...
  (gdb) run -verbose
should start up the server and land you back in gdb when it exits or crashes.

/usr/bin/Xorg: symbol lookup error: /usr/lib/xorg/modules/drivers//intel_drv.so: undefined symbol: drmCheckModesettingSupported

Program exited with code 0177.
-----
the driver is compiled for the running xorg server.
Comment 8 Jesse Barnes 2009-04-13 13:33:57 UTC
Sounds like you built against a libdrm with mode setting support, but aren't running against it, since drmCheckModesettingSupported is in libdrm.
Comment 9 kevin kaploe 2009-04-13 13:47:47 UTC
(In reply to comment #8)
> Sounds like you built against a libdrm with mode setting support, but aren't
> running against it, since drmCheckModesettingSupported is in libdrm.
> 

yea kernel 2.6.29 has it but my wireless driver doesn't work on 2.6.29 at the moment so i am stuck on 2.6.28, it loads but refuses to talk to my router which it did on the standard ralink drivers before they were put in the kernel. 

the libdrm i have is marked stable on gentoo and was pulled in with the rest of xorg-server 1.5.3 when that was marked stable.
Comment 10 Donnie Berkholz 2009-04-13 19:44:06 UTC
Could you try rebuilding your intel driver? What Jesse is saying is that you may have built it against a different version of libdrm than you currently have installed.
